What is an advertisement buyer?

Advertisers buy advertising space on television, radio, and print media.

An advertiser pays for the time they want their message to appear.

They don't necessarily seek the best ad; they want to reach their target markets with the most effective ad.

An advertiser might have details about potential customers, including their age, gender and income.

This data can be used by the advertiser to decide which media is most effective for them. For example, they might decide that direct mail would be more effective with older audiences.

Advertisers also look at the competition. Advertisers will look at the competition to see if similar businesses are nearby.

In addition, advertisers consider the size of their budget and the amount of time they have to spend their money before it expires.


What is branding?

Branding is how you communicate who you are and what you stand for. It's how people remember you and your name.

Branding is about creating a memorable brand identity for your company. A brand does not only include a logo, but includes everything that you look like and how your voice is used by employees.

A strong brand makes customers feel more confident about buying from you. Customers feel confident in choosing your products to those of their competitors.

A good example of a well-branded company is Apple. Apple's brand is well-known for its stylish design, high-quality products and outstanding customer support.

Apple's name has become synonymous for technology. People think of Apple whenever they see a computer or smartphone.

You should think about creating a brand if you are considering starting a business. This will give you and your business a face.

What is affiliate Marketing?

Affiliate marketing is an internet business model in which you refer customers to other products and services. You get paid by the product owner when someone buys from them.

Affiliate marketing is built on referrals. For people to purchase from your site, they don't need anything extra. Simply refer people to the website.

You don't have to sell anything. Selling is as easy as buying.

Even affiliate accounts can be set up in just minutes.

You will get more commission if you refer more people.
